Anthony Cervino, the founder of The FF Faceoff podcast, passed away unexpectedly on June 5, 2025.
As of now, the specific cause of his unexpected passing has not been publicly disclosed.
His demise news came as a shock to both his loved ones and the wider fantasy football community.
Anthony Cervino Is Survived By His Wife, Maggie, And 10-Year-Old Son!
Anthony, originally from Pine Beach, New Jersey, Cervino was the co-creator of the FF Faceoff Mental Health Podathon in partnership with the Hayden Hurst Foundation.
He was also an NFL writer and betting analyst for various platforms like RotoWire, FantasyPros, and The Game Day.
Moreover, he achieved notable rankings in the FantasyPros Expert Consensus Rankings (ECR), including a top-15 overall finish in 2019 and 2021.
He was ranked second for quarterback accuracy and third for tight end accuracy in 2021.
A prominent figure in the fantasy football community, Anthony Cervino was affectionately known as @therealNFLguru.
